Saved by 'baby bump'



DAPHNE IKING (pic) looked radiant when met at a perfume launch event in KLCC recently.

But behind that beautiful smile, Daphne is nursing some cuts and bruises a fter falling into a manhole just a few days before.

“I was at Jalan Alor to have a dinner meeting with the Bella (ntv7) team and I was walking up and down the pavement trying to get a glimpse of the crew's car (they were lost).

"Then I spotted them, so I ran to grab their attention that they had found the place — and then I fell unglamorously into a manhole!” said the Sabahan beauty.

She was on her own, while her husband Azmi Abdul Rahman (Joe) waited for their table with her three-year-old daughter Isobel Daniella, unaware she had fallen.

Iking’s ex-hubby bares all over why he had to ‘wash dirty linen in public’

Triangular affair: Chong (left) was quite sure that Iking was having an affair with Choy but he could not sit down and do nothing when he found out that Isobel was not his child.

Some journalists covering the sensational Daphne Iking enticement case found Ryan Chong Yiing Yih unapproachable.

The perception may be justified as the TV personality’s former husband kept his distance from the press, looking serious and avoiding eye contact with journalists.

It was the opposite image for Darren Choy Khin Ming, the man Chong accused of enticing his wife even though he knew that she was married. He blamed Choy of wanting to have sex with her then. Arguably, most journalists were with Team Darren. He is handsome and has a ready smile.

So, it came as a surprise when on the day Choy was acquitted of the charge, Chong agreed to an interview. (Choy had apologised openly in court to Chong for having embarrassed him over the affair). Apparently, the businessman’s lawyers had given him specific instructions not to comment on the case.

And, at the interview on Monday, the 33-year-old, six-footer came across as a “gentle giant”.

Daphne Iking's ex-husband admits he had affair with GRO in China

Daphne Iking’s ex-husband Ryan Chong Yiing Yih also had an affair while they were still married, the Magistrate's court heard Monday.

Businessman Chong, 32, who has taken corporate figure Darren Choy Khin Ming, 45, to court in a private summons for "enticing his wife", confessed that he had "met someone" while working in China.

When cross-examined by Choy's counsel Datuk Jagjit Singh, he admitted he had met a guest-relations officer (GRO) named Serena in a karaoke club in Shanghai, in June 2007.

However, he said he confessed the matter to a pregnant Iking a month later, in July, seeking her forgiveness because he felt he had done wrong, and said she had forgiven him.

Jagjit then put it to him that he was lying, saying that he had confessed to Iking because Serena had contacted Iking via her (Iking's) blog, which was the reason he had made the confession to Iking before she could confront him about it.

Chong disagreed, saying Iking was not aware of the matter before he told her about it.

He also denied paying Serena RMB2mil (about RM941,000) to buy her silence.
